Goodbye Pontiac: Last unit rolls off the assembly line, a G6 sedan

General Motors built the last Pontiac for the U.S. market on Wednesday, reports The Detroit News. The white Pontiac G6 sedan rolled off the assembly line around 12:45 p.m and there was no celebration, GM officials or media on hand. 2009 Pontiac G6 to get new 4-cylinder SE model

Ever since Pontiac’s G6 Coupe and Convertible made their debut in 2006, they have carried a 3.5 liter V6 engine. Back then the Pontiac G6 used to make close to 200-hp.
